Acts 10:19-29

19 While Kefa's mind was still on the vision, the Spirit said, "Three men are looking for you.
20 Get up, go downstairs, and have no misgivings about going with them, because I myself have sent them."
21 So Kefa went down and said to the men, "You were looking for me? Here I am. What brings you here?"
22 They answered, "Cornelius. He's a Roman army officer, an upright man and a God-fearer, a man highly regarded by the whole Jewish nation; and he was told by a holy angel to have you come to his house and listen to what you have to say."
23 So Kefa invited them to be his guests. The next day, he got up and went with them, accompanied by some of the brothers from Yafo;
24 and he arrived at Caesarea the day after that. Cornelius was expecting them - he had already called together his relatives and close friends.
25 As Kefa entered the house, Cornelius met him and fell prostrate at his feet.
26 But Kefa pulled him to his feet and said, "Stand up! I myself am just a man."
27 As he talked with him, Kefa went inside and found many people gathered.
28 He said to them, "You are well aware that for a man who is a Jew to have close association with someone who belongs to another people, or to come and visit him, is something that just isn't done. But God has shown me not to call any person common or unclean;
29 so when I was summoned, I came without raising any questions. Tell me, then, why did you send for me?"
